Traci Brimhall Hybrids and Hermit Crabs: Lyric Forms in Creative Nonfiction Non-Fiction July 29 to August 23, 2019 Number of Participants: 15 Price: $500 Format:

In this class we will examine essays that take their forms from other sources in order to write our own. We will look at pieces that borrow form from documents like quizzes, medical charts, and rejection letters, and try and find inspiration in our own everyday documents. We will also look at the braided essay, and nonfiction that uses poetic forms like sonnets, sestinas, and ghazals to find their structures before trying our own. Let your writing cross lines and bend genre and move into a new form!

Biography

Traci Brimhall is the author of Come the Slumberless to the Land of Nod (Copper Canyon, 2020), Saudade (Copper Canyon, 2017), Our Lady of the Ruins (W.W. Norton, 2012), and Rookery (Southern Illinois University Press, 2010). Her poems have appeared in The New Yorker, Slate, Poetry, The Believer, The New Republic, New York Times Magazine, and Best American Poetry. A 2013 NEA Fellow, she is a Professor of Creative Writing at Kansas State University.
